240 发简信
IP属地:上海
  • Thread Join使用

    Thread Join在我们实际业务场景中使用的场景可能不是很多,java.util.concurrent包下面已经提供很多种方式来帮我们解决线...

  • CyclicBarrier使用

    CyclicBarrier循环屏障(障碍),同样都是jdk线程并发包下的java.util.concurrent,底层使用ReentrantLo...

  • CountDownLatch使用

    CountDownLatch结合多线程可以控制并发,异步先行,并发阻塞,充分利用多核cpu,同时处理多项事情,底层实现是sync、volatil...

  • Semaphore使用

    Semaphore:信号量通常用于限制线程的数量访问一些(物理或逻辑)资源。个人理解:限流、控制访问量。使用场景:竞争仅有的资源、一个车厢最多可...

  • Spring Event使用

    SpringEvent 自定义事件链,实用性很强的一种设计,可以利用它来做业务剥离,复杂场景解耦、代码独立等,也是事件驱动模型的核心,并且可以处...

    0.1 3152 0 3 1
  • Resize,w 360,h 240
    Nacos配置中心

    本文介绍spring cloud 集成 nacos案例 官方文档:https://nacos.io/zh-cn/docs/what-is-nac...

  • Resize,w 360,h 240
    ElasticSearch基本查询(入门级)

    小白入口:ElasticSearch官网ElasticSearch GitHub地址 为了方便理解es中的关系,es的index、type可以看...

  • MySQL开发规范

    一、基础规范 表字符集使用 UTF8 所有表都需要添加注释 不在数据库中存储图⽚、文件等大数据 禁止在线上做数据库压力测试 禁⽌从测试、开发环境...